Բովանդակություն:

Arduino-tomation Մաս 3: 5 քայլեր
Arduino-tomation Մաս 3: 5 քայլեր
Anonim
Arduino-tomation Մաս 3
Arduino-tomation Մաս 3

Մեկ այլ մեքենա ՝ ժամանակակից ձևով փոխակերպվելու համար: Ինչի համար? Ավտոմատացման մեթոդներին ծանոթանալու համար:

Քայլ 1. Գործառնական մասի (OP) նկարագրություն

Գործառնական մասի (OP) նկարագրություն
Գործառնական մասի (OP) նկարագրություն

Այս փոքրիկ հիմար մեքենան ավելի փոքր մոդել է, որն օգտագործվում է արդյունաբերական գործարաններում ՝ մետաղական կտորների քիմիական մաքրման կամ որևէ այլ բանի համար…

Այն պատրաստված է մի փոքրիկ մեքենայից, որը վերցնում է ամեն ինչով լի զամբյուղը և այն տեղափոխում տեղից տեղ (5 տեղ): Երկու DC 24V շարժիչներ թույլ են տալիս ուղղահայաց և հորիզոնական շարժումներ կատարել: Սենսորները ցույց են տալիս մեքենայի տարբեր դիրքերը:

Քայլ 2. Ավելացրեք ժամանակակից հմտություններ

Ավելացնել ժամանակակից հմտություններ
Ավելացնել ժամանակակից հմտություններ
Ավելացնել ժամանակակից հմտություններ
Ավելացնել ժամանակակից հմտություններ
Ավելացնել ժամանակակից հմտություններ
Ավելացնել ժամանակակից հմտություններ

Ես որոշեցի օգտագործել arduino- ի կլոն `հիմնված tha atmega1284P- ի վրա, որը ներառում է բավականաչափ I/O` համակարգը վերահսկելու համար: Ես նաև օգտագործում եմ արդյունաբերական սենսորային էկրան (իմ հայտնի COOLMAY MT6037H-W), որն արդուինոյի հետ շփվում է W5100 ethernet վահանի շնորհիվ modbus-tcp արձանագրության մեջ:

Քայլ 3. Սխեմաներ և ծրագրեր

Նպատակս նկարագրելու համար անհրաժեշտ են մի քանի հիանալի ուղեցույցներ.

-ծրագրի պետական մեքենան ուղղակիորեն փոխարկվում է արդուինոյի էսքիզի SM գրադարանի հետ:

-SFC (ֆրանսերեն GRAFCET), IEC61131 պայմանագրով (արդյունաբերական մեթոդ):

Ես ձեզ նույնպես տալիս եմ համակարգի սխեմաները:

Կարող եք գտնել նաև 2 ծրագիր.

-arduino ուրվագիծը (TraitSurf1284.rar)

-HMI էսքիզը (TraitSurf.rar)

Քայլ 4: Արտակարգ իրավիճակների ուղեցույց. Ինչ անել արտակարգ իրավիճակների կամ միացման դեպքում…

Ֆրանսիայում մենք օգտագործում ենք GEMMA (Guide des Modes de Marches et d'Arrêt) ուղեցույցը, որը նկարագրում է մեքենան աշխատեցնելու տարբեր քայլերը:

Այս հատուկ էջում գրված է վահանակի յուրաքանչյուր կոճակ և լույս, և ինչ անել արտակարգ իրավիճակների, անսարքության, կոտրված կտորների, վատ արտադրության դեպքում:…

Կարծես խենթ պատկեր է, բայց դա այնքան օգտակար է, երբ չգիտես ինչ անել այս հիմար մեքենայի հետ:

PS: IC: Նախնական պայմաններ. Մեքենան դատարկ է, բարձր և C1- ով

OP: Համակարգի գործառնական մասը

Քայլ 5: Եզրակացություն

Դա շատ լավ մեքենա է այն ուսանողների համար, ովքեր ցանկանում են սովորել ավտոմատացում և ծրագրավորման լուծումներ: Այստեղ դուք կարող եք ծրագրավորել ձեր մեքենան միայն C լեզվով (ոչ IEC31131), եթե ցանկանում եք LADDER լեզվական եղանակ, օգտագործեք LDmicro (տե՛ս իմ նախորդ հրահանգներից մեկը ՝ IEC61131 համաձայնագիրը): Պետական մեքենաների ծրագրավորման համար օգտագործեք Yakindu (ոչ IEC61131), բայց այն չի աշխատում կլոնով, այնպես որ փոխեք կլոնը MEGA2560 տախտակի վրա, SFC ծրագրավորման համար (IEC61131 պայմանագիր) օգտագործեք GRAFCET STUDIO- ն միայն arduino DUE- ով (որոշ ուղղումներ սխեմատիկայում պետք է պատրաստվի):

Շնորհակալություն ամբողջ աշխարհում հայտնաբերված բոլոր հետաքրքիր կայքերի համար:

Ուրախ հրահանգներ !!!

Խորհուրդ ենք տալիս: